
Обзор
Aspose.Slides for .NET — это полноценная библиотека для обработки презентаций, созданная для разработчиков, которым требуются надежные и высокопроизводительные серверные и настольные решения для создания, изменения, конвертации и рендеринга файлов презентаций. Эта библиотека устраняет необходимость в автоматизации Microsoft Office на серверах и предоставляет полный набор API для программной работы с презентациями в .NET-приложениях.
Описание продукта
Библиотека поддерживает широкий спектр форматов презентаций и обеспечивает точный контроль над содержимым слайдов. Она предназначена для интеграции в цепочки генерации документов, системы отчетности, платформы управления контентом и пользовательские приложения, требующие автоматизированной обработки презентаций. Разработчики могут работать со слайдами, фигурами, диаграммами, таблицами, анимацией, заметками и мастер-слайдами, используя единообразную модель объектов и понятные соглашения API.
Как это работает
Компонент предоставляет управляемый API, который напрямую читает и записывает файлы презентаций. Он разбирает структуру презентаций в логическую модель объектов, что позволяет разработчикам получать доступ к отдельным слайдам, фигурам, фрагментам текста, изображениям и мультимедийным элементам. Модули рендеринга конвертируют слайды в изображения и PDF, а процедуры конверсии сопоставляют элементы презентации между форматами. Библиотека также эффективно кэширует и потоково передает содержимое, снижая использование памяти при операциях в масштабах сервера.
Основные возможности
- Создание, редактирование и сохранение презентаций в распространенных форматах, включая PPT, PPTX и другие совместимые типы
- Рендеринг слайдов в изображения, PDF и XPS для просмотра и распространения
- Программное применение и изменение мастер-слайдов, макетов, тем и шаблонов
- Работа с фигурами, текстом, таблицами, диаграммами, SmartArt и встроенными медиа
- Поддержка анимации, переходов, времени показа слайдов и заметок
- Объединение, разделение и переупорядочение слайдов для автоматизированной сборки презентаций
- Извлечение текста, изображений и метаданных для поиска и индексирования
- Экспорт с высокой точностью с опциями DPI, форматами изображений и цветовыми профилями
- Поддержка шифрования, защиты паролем и управления свойствами документов
- Потоковый API и функции производительности, оптимизированные для серверных сред
Преимущества
Использование этой библиотеки ускоряет разработку, предоставляя готовую функциональность для обработки презентаций. Команды могут создавать надежные решения без зависимости от настольных компонентов Office, что снижает сложность развертывания и риски лицензирования. API разработан удобным для .NET-разработчиков, что позволяет быстро реализовать такие возможности, как генерация отчетов по шаблонам, пакетная конвертация и динамическая сборка слайдов.
Операционные преимущества включают улучшенную производительность на серверах, предсказуемое использование памяти и параметры многопоточности, которые помогают масштабироваться до сценариев с высокой пропускной способностью. Возможности рендеринга и конверсии обеспечивают стабильные результаты в разных средах, а работа с нативными элементами презентаций сохраняет точность при импорте и экспорте файлов. Это делает библиотеку особенно подходящей для корпоративных рабочих процессов, где важны точность и надежность.
Типичные области применения
- Автоматическая генерация презентационных отчетов из баз данных и инструментов бизнес-аналитики
- Серверная конвертация презентаций в PDF или изображения для веб-доставки и архивирования
- Динамическое создание слайдов для персонализированных маркетинговых материалов и коммерческих предложений
- Создание миниатюр и предварительных просмотров для систем управления документами и поисковых интерфейсов
- Объединение и переупорядочение слайдов для сборки пользовательских наборов из библиотек шаблонов
- Извлечение текста и ресурсов для анализа контента, индексирования и проверок соответствия
- Рендеринг слайдов для поддержки мобильных и мало полосных сценариев
- Это установщик, а не само программное обеспечение – меньше, быстрее и удобнее
- Установка в один клик – без ручной настройки
- Установщик загружает полный Aspose.Slides for .NET 2026.
Как установить
- Скачайте и распакуйте ZIP-файл
- Откройте извлечённую папку и запустите установочный файл
- Когда Windows покажет синее окно «неизвестное приложение»:
- Нажмите Подробнее → Всё равно выполнить
- Нажмите Да в окне контроля учётных записей
- Дождитесь автоматической установки (~1 минута)
- Нажмите Начать загрузку
- После завершения загрузки запустите программу с ярлыка на рабочем столе
- Наслаждайтесь
Заключение
Для разработчиков и организаций, которые обрабатывают презентации в больших объёмах, эта библиотека предоставляет зрелый и функционально насыщенный набор инструментов для управления каждым этапом жизненного цикла презентаций. От создания контента и работы с шаблонами до высокоточного рендеринга и безопасного распространения, она закрывает разрыв между средствами авторинга и автоматизированными системами. Независимо от того, строите ли вы внутренние движки отчетности, клиентские порталы или сервисы конверсии контента, компонент обеспечивает команды разработчиков API, необходимые для получения стабильных и качественных результатов при минимальных инфраструктурных зависимостях.
Начать просто благодаря подробной документации, практическим примерам и ресурсам сообщества. С гибкими моделями лицензирования и поддержкой распространённых корпоративных сценариев библиотеку можно интегрировать в рабочие процессы разработки и конвейеры развертывания с минимальными препятствиями. Результат — масштабируемый и удобный в поддержке подход к автоматизации презентаций, который позволяет командам сосредоточиться на бизнес-логике, а не на тонкостях форматов файлов.